SAN FRANCISCO, December 22, 2025 – Google is set to considerably expand its capacity for artificial intelligence progress through a deal with Intersect, a company specializing in data centers and energy solutions. The move signals a continued, aggressive investment by the tech giant in the rapidly evolving AI landscape.

The Rising Demand for AI Infrastructure

The demand for data center capacity is surging as companies race to deploy AI technologies. This isn’t just about processing power; it’s about energy efficiency and sustainability. Intersect’s focus on integrating energy solutions into its data center designs is especially appealing to Google, which has made notable commitments to renewable energy.

Did you know? data centers account for roughly 1% of global electricity consumption, and that number is expected to rise with the growth of AI.

Intersect’s unique Approach

intersect distinguishes itself by developing data centers that are not only powerful but also environmentally responsible. The company’s approach involves innovative cooling technologies and on-site energy generation, reducing reliance on conventional power grids. This aligns with Google’s broader sustainability goals and could provide a competitive advantage as the demand for green data centers increases.
